slum/slʌm/ n. & v.●n. 1 an overcrowded and squalid backstreet, district, etc., usu. in a city and inhabited by very poor people (通常位于城市中的)贫民窟,贫民区 2 a house or building unfit for human habitation (不适合人居住的)破旧房子 ●v. intr. (slummed, slumming) 1 live in slumlike conditions 过贫民生活 2 go about the slums through curiosity, to examine the condition of the inhabitants, or for charitable purposes (为了解居民生活或为慈善目而)访问贫民区 □ slum it colloq. put up with conditions less comfortable than usual [口]忍受较差的生活条件 □ slummy adj. (slummier, slummiest)□ slumminess n.[19th c.: originally slang] |
